Warforged Subraces
Warforged Traits
  Ability Score Increase: Your Constitution score increases
  by 1
  Size: Medium
  Warforged Resilience: You have resistance to poison
  damage and advantage on saves against being poisoned.
  You are immune to disease, and don't need to eat, drink, or
  breathe. You also don't need to sleep, and don't suffer
  exhaustion from lack of rest. Magic can't put you to sleep.
  Sentry's Rest: When you take a long rest, you must spend
  at least 6 hours of it in an inactive, motionless state. You
  appear unconscious, but can see or hear as normal.
  Integrated Protection: You have a natural armor class.
  You don't benefit from wearing armor except shields. Each
  time you finish a long rest, choose one of the following
  protection modes, provided you meet the mode's
  prerequisite.

  Languages: You can speak, read, and write Common.

Enforcer
The enforcer model warforged were made to fought enemies
head on with their claw like limbs and extra set of hands to
can climb or hang from any surface to keep fighting its foes.
enforcer traits
   Ability score increases: Your Strength score increases by
   2
   Clawed strider: You were built with clawed like limbs to
   climb terrain while fighting or to ambush foes. Gain
   climbing speed of 30 feet.
   Six-limb Five weapons: The enforcer has a total of four
   arms with each equipped with 3 claw like fingers and its 2
   legs also has 3 claws like fingers. You can have up to 5
   weapons equipped in the same time by halving your
   movement halved or just have four equipped single handed
   or 2 two-handed weapons equipped and can use the
   grapple action with a free leg and the enforcer can use its
   four arms to walk while fighting with its legs too.(note:
   this doesn’t mean that the enforcer can attack more
   times than the class allows it except for npc’s.)
   Clawed limbs: The claws are a natural weapon that deals
   1d4 +strength piercing damage.
Mermen
The Mermen are the aquatic warforged model made to survey
an underwater area for enemies and if possible eliminate the
threats.
   Ability score increases: Your Wisdom score increases by
   2
   Jet Fins: Your fins absorbs water through one end and
   uses it like a water jet to move underwater and while
   swimming. You have a swimming speed of 40 feet and can
   use the Dash action as a Bonus action while swimming.
   Aquatic awareness: While underwater you can use a
   Bonus action to shut down your visual receptors (or eyes in
   other word) to activate blindsight for a radius of 60 feet
   for 10 minutes and can be use once per long or short
   rest.
   Bladed fins: The fins count as a natural weapon that deals
   1d4 +strength slashing damage.

Seraph
The seraph model was designed for supporting the other
models with high magic air support or as a spotter during a
storm for other models or as help for the appointed leader
devising strategies and tactics.
   Ability score increases: Your Intelligent score increases
   by 2
   Predatory Wings: You were built with a pair of
   mechanical wings and have a flying speed of 30 feet.
   Weathered Shell: You have resistance to lightning
   damage.
   Tactical-sight: while flying you have advantage on
   perception roles.
